Southside Mini-Storage

Closed
Call
5525 S Staples St Ste E3
Corpus Christi, TX 78411

Southside Mini-Storage, located in Corpus Christi, TX, offers a convenient and secure solution for all your storage needs. With various unit sizes available, it caters to both personal and business storage requirements. The facility is equipped with modern security features, ensuring that your belongings are safe and accessible whenever you need them.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esTexasCorpus ChristiSouthside Mini-Storage

Partial Data by Foursquare.